Adani Green Energy, through its subsidiary Adani Renewable Energy (RJ,) has announced the commissioning of the balance 100 MW capacity on August, 21 2019, in the state of Rajasthan out of the 200 MW solar power project capacity that the group had won in a piloted by the Maharashtra State Electricity Distribution Company Limited (MSEDCL).
The company has previously agreed on a Power Purchase Agreement (PPA) with MSECL with a fixed tariff rate of Rs. 2.71/kWh for a period of 25 years.
As per the company, the first batch or the first 100 MW capacity of the plant had been commissioned earlier in the month on August 2, 2019
